Shirley Steffens
Associate Professor
Education
- Ph.D. Special Education, University of Wisconsin-Madison, 1996
- Learning Disabilities Endorsement (K-9) for Nebraska Professional Teaching Certificate, 1985
- M.A. Education Psychology and Measurements, University of Nebraska-Lincoln, 1983
- B.S. Elementary Education with endorsement in EMH (Educable Mentally Handicapped), Dana College, 1977
Courses Taught
- 62-371 Introduction to Special Education
- 62-470 Assessment in Special Education
- 62-471 Assessment in Special Education/Lab
- 62-635 Techniques for Conferencing and Collaboration
- 62-652 Psych-Ed Measurement
- 62-699 Seminar: Selected Topics in Special Education
- 71-101 Freshman Seminar
Academic Interests
- Assessment in Special Education
- Collaboration and Consultation
Scholarly Activity
- Steffens, S., Nielson, C., Doyle, L., & Spencer, C. (Oct. 21, 2011) "Selecting your Palette: A Panel on Intelligence Tests." Presented at national Council for Diagnostic Services Conference, Kansas City, MO.
- Steffens, S., Foley, N., & Farnan, S. (Nov. 10, 2011). "A Vision for Course Redesign: Introduction to Special Education." Presented at the 34th Annual Teacher Education Division - Council for Exceptional Children Conference, Austin, TX.
- Steffens, S., Nielson, C., Doyle, L., & Spencer, C. (Oct. 12, 2010). "Comparisons of The Big Three Achievements Tests: WJ-III, WIAT-III, and KTEA-III." Presented at the National Council for Diagnostic Services Conference, San Antonio, TX.
- Foley, N. & Steffens, S. (Nov. 8, 2010) "Addressing Continuing Teacher Shortages Through Online Teacher Preparation: Lessons Learned." Presented at the 33rd Annual Teacher Education Division - Council for Exceptional Children Conference, St. Louis, MO.
- Hallock, P. & Steffens, S. (Nov. 10-14, 2009). "Responding to Response to Intervention: Preparing new Teachers for RTI." Presented at the 32nd Teacher Education Division - Council for Exceptional Children Conference, Charlotte, NC.
